Opened 9 years ago

Closed 7 months ago

#6440 closed bug (invalid)

Fonts embedding in the PDF driver doesn't work

Reported by: mjkerpan Owned by: nobody
Priority: normal Milestone: R1
Component: Printing Version: R1/alpha2
Keywords: Cc:
Blocked By: Blocking:
Has a Patch: no Platform: All

Description

While testing Haiku in VirtualBox, I discovered that fonts are not properly embedded in PDFs created by printing from StyledEdit to to the PDF Writer. I was using Charter as my test font, and the driver settings SAY that it should be embedded, but it clearly isn't. Screenshots and sample files included

Attachments (5)

screenshot1.png (9.7 KB) - added by mjkerpan 9 years ago.
What things look like in StyledEdit
screenshot2.png (15.6 KB) - added by mjkerpan 9 years ago.
What things look like in the basic print settings dialog
screenshot3.png (11.0 KB) - added by mjkerpan 9 years ago.
What the font settings dialog looks like
screenshot4.png (22.2 KB) - added by mjkerpan 9 years ago.
The final result in BePDF. Not pretty…
test.pdf (1.5 KB) - added by mjkerpan 9 years ago.
The PDF file itself.

Download all attachments as: .zip

Change History (7)

Changed 9 years ago by mjkerpan

Attachment: screenshot1.png added

What things look like in StyledEdit

Changed 9 years ago by mjkerpan

Attachment: screenshot2.png added

What things look like in the basic print settings dialog

Changed 9 years ago by mjkerpan

Attachment: screenshot3.png added

What the font settings dialog looks like

Changed 9 years ago by mjkerpan

Attachment: screenshot4.png added

The final result in BePDF. Not pretty...

Changed 9 years ago by mjkerpan

Attachment: test.pdf added

The PDF file itself.

comment:1 Changed 7 years ago by humdinger

Owner: changed from laplace to nobody
Status: newassigned

comment:2 Changed 7 months ago by waddlesplash

Resolution: invalid
Status: assignedclosed

The PDF printer has been moved out of the tree, so a ticket should be opened at its new home instead, which I've done: https://github.com/HaikuArchives/PDFWriter/issues/5

Note: See TracTickets for help on using tickets.